Description and traits of Douglas fir trees

The Douglas fir, a large coniferous tree, is known for its height, commonly reaching 200-300 ft, and its pyramid-formed crown. Its bark has deep furrows along with a reddish-brown shade. The tree provides cones that develop upright and have unique three-pronged bracts. Douglas firs are extended-lived, with some trees reaching about one,000 years old.

There are two principal sorts of the Douglas fir: the Coastline wide variety, located in the Pacific Northwest, plus the Rocky Mountain wide range, located in the Rocky Mountains. Coast Douglas firs are likely to improve taller and possess thicker bark, whilst Rocky Mountain Douglas firs have reasonably shorter needles in addition to a more quickly progress charge.

The trees are important timber sources due to their robust and durable Wooden, that's used for building, flooring, and household furniture. Coastline Douglas firs are especially worthwhile for his or her timber, noted for currently being straight, strong, and resistant to decay.

Douglas fir forests deliver essential habitats for wildlife, offering nesting web-sites for birds and shelter for mammals. The seeds of your tree may also be a foods supply for different little mammals and birds. General, Douglas fir trees Enjoy an important function inside the ecosystems they inhabit.

Discussion on the growth fees of Douglas fir trees

Coastline Douglas fir trees have a quicker development fee as compared to Rocky Mountain Douglas fir trees. Coastline Douglas firs are usually located in coastal locations, the place they could expand as much as 250 toes tall and possess a trunk diameter of 6 toes. Alternatively, Rocky Mountain Douglas firs, located in the interior regions, have a slower growth fee and therefore are generally scaled-down in measurement, reaching up to one hundred thirty toes in top that has a trunk diameter of three toes.
